Applications are invited for a PhD doctoral researcher within the UCD School of Politics and International Relations to deliver the research objectives of a project funded by the Irish Research Council. The project applies methods from quantitative text analysis/NLP in Arabic and cognitive mapping (Axelrod 1976) to examine interviews with participants in Muslim resistance movements.

You will conduct a specified programme of doctoral research to contribute to specific work packages of the project, under the supervision and direction of the Principal Investigator - Dr. Stephanie Dornschneider-Elkink.

You will be given the autonomy to design your own research questions within the scope of the project. But as part of this, you will be tasked with text analysis in Arabic and support the development of new tools to convert Arabic text into cognitive maps. Tasks will include POS tagging, sequence analysis, visualization, and web-scraping.

Knowledge of Arabic is a plus but not a requirement.
